Book excerpt: Excerpt from Clinical Pathology This book represents an attempt to describe in a reasonable compass such laboratory investigations, whether chemical, histological or bacteriological, as have a practical bearing upon the diagnosis and treatment of disease; to give some account of their meaning, and to assess, so far as possible, their value in practice. Many of the smaller text-books of Clinical Pathology deal with the subject only in part; the complexity of methods in the larger works renders them more suitable to special investigators, and it was felt that a book of intermediate size might be of use to the student and practitioner. The reduction in size has been mainly arrived at by avoidance of a reduplication of methods, in preference to the omission of any essential branch of the subject. Where several methods for the same object are in use, one, or at most two, are described in full: the remainder are omitted altogether. Much of scientific interest has been necessarily sacrificed to the practical application of diagnostic methods, and the book has consequently no pretensions to consideration as anything more than an adjunct to clinical medicine. No list of references is given, and the names of authorities, unless definitely associated with a particular reaction, are for the most part omitted. Book excerpt: Excerpt from A Manual of Clinical Laboratory Methods IN offering this manual for the use of students and practitioners, the object is to present clinical laboratory methods in concise and accessible form. While devoted largely to a description of methods, the underlying principles, the indications for performing tests and the significance of the results are outlined. Accordingly the plan adopted in most chapters has been as follows: (1) Outline of routine examina tions; (2) description of the simpler qualitative methods which are frequently employed; (3) description of quantitative methods or those of intricate technic; (4) discussion of findings in various morbid condi' tions. When several methods are given, usually the preferred one is indicated. Details are entered into more fully in some cases than in others. For example, the method of counting blood cells has been given meticulously, since it is elementary and its procedures are among the first which must be mastered by the student. It may seem that disproportionate attention has been given to certain subjects, such as the histology and pathology of the blood, but experience in teaching has shown this to be desirable. It is hoped that both the liberal use of cross references in the body of the text and the synoptic resumes of quantitative procedures in the chapters on Blood and Urine, will facilitate use of the book in the clinical laboratory. The bibliography, which will be found at the end of the text, contains references to original articles on the newer methods, and will prove helpful to readers desiring to consult the literature.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Clinical Pathology of the Blood The following translation was authorised by Professor v. Limbeck shortly before his premature death, and represents the latest German edition save for the fact that Dr. Freund's chapter, which deals chiefly with the physio logical aspects of blood 'coagulation, and certain other passages have been considerably condensed. Professor V. Limbeck had a world-wide reputation as an authority upon all points connected with the physiology, pathology, and chemistry of the blood, and his early death was a heavy blow to every one interested in these subjects. He was a man of singularly engaging nature and of enormous capacity for work, and notwithstanding the many calls upon his time, was ever ready to help any who, like ourselves, had the inestimable' privilege of working with him. In addition to this Professor v. Limbeck combined many qualities which are not always associated with great learning. He was generously appreciative of the work done by others whilst on those rare occasions on which he was shown to be at fault, he was the first to admit his error. A touch of quiet humour and gentle satire also character ised him, as may be seen in the few but telling words with which he dismisses the plausible theory of Bunge, and the preposterous one of Neusser.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Practical Clinical Laboratory Diagnosis: A Thoroughly Illustrated Laboratory Guide, Embodying the Interpretation of Laboratory, Findings, Designed for the Use of Students, and Practitioners of Medicine Several years of teaching Clinical Laboratory Diag nosis, making laboratory examinations and often interpret ing the findings, has forcibly impressed us with the need of such a book as this is intended to be. We take up only those laboratory examinations that are useful in ordinary, every-day practice and do not include tests that are seldom used or that are practical only for special laborato'ry workers. Our plan throughout the book is to give only one method of making a test or examination. We select what we con sider the best, simplest, most practical method of making each test and do not sacrifice space or clearness by giving several tests or methods for obtaining the same information. All apparatus employed are specified, usually illustrated, and when thought to be advantageous, a source of supply considered reliable is given. Reagents are all specified, the formulae given, and an economical and practical source of supply is stated when thought advantageous.
